Welcome to the Cartwheel load-testing crew! Before you review our checkout flow hammering setup, know that all synthetic orders route through the Pinefort staging gateway, never production. The harness caps at 500 requests per second and tags everything with a test header. To run the suite locally against staging, you'll need the key below.

app token of yajeg-kawef = kto11_7En3XSX8xQw

**Q: How do I verify changes to the Chalkline timetable solver?**

Run the constraint regression suite before approving. It replays 40 anonymized term schedules from the Brindlewood pilot and fails on any hard-constraint violation or >5% soft-score drop. Solver heuristics live in `packer/`; don't approve changes there without a benchmark diff attached. Flaky runs usually mean nondeterministic tie-breaking — flag it. The reviewer checklist and benchmark harness docs are on the internal page here.

runbook for badug-kadup: https://confluence.zemvarlabs.internal/projects/browse/display/projects/bd1b

## Service Accounts — StormFan Alert Fan-Out

The fan-out worker authenticates to the internal dispatch tier using the svc-stormfan account. Rotate quarterly; scopes are limited to publish-only on alert topics. If deliveries stall during your shift, verify the worker is using the current credential, reproduced below for reference.

API key for kaweg-hahif: kto4_rAjZ

Ticket: Staging env misconfigured for Siftgate bloom filter

The bloom layer in front of the Pellet KV store is rejecting all lookups in staging because the env file was copied from the dev template without credentials. False-positive tuning values are fine; only the auth line is missing. To unblock the weekly demo, the Pellet admission secret must be set on the following line.

env line for yaguf-fajop: LEDGER_TOKEN13=fb08984397349